Extensive research on RFID indicates that this is not yet another hype, but can have a definite impact on Supply Chain operations.

Labor Cost Savings: Recording items received in a shipment with barcodes attached each pallet is labor intensive as it requires manually placing each item in the line-of-sight of a barcode reader. But the same pallets equipped with RFID would record all items in the shipment, when a fork-lift carrying the shipment passes under a RF-reader installed on the doorway.

Improved Processes: The information about arriving shipments can be used to automatically relay Shipment Arrival Notices. Automated reading of RF tags will provide warehouse managers information about the accurate location of the pallets in the warehouse. Information from GPS systems installed in transportation vehicles when merged with data from RF tags can help pin-point the exact location of any individual pallet.

Reduce Shipping Errors: Shipment errors occur mostly due to employee oversight, and such errors are common and tolerated as cost of doing business. Oversight occurs mainly because of the manual verifying process when loading pallets into transportation vehicles. RFID has the potential to eliminate shipping errors totally or reduce it significantly. A RF reader placed at the dispatch point notifies the loader immediately of any error shipments by comparing destination of transport vehicle with the intended destination and route of the pallet.
